Doctor of Ministry Scholarships
The purpose of the Doctor of Ministry Scholarship is to further theological education in congregational ministry and to support the re-energizing of pastors through higher education. Scholarships, in the amount of $1,000/person, are awarded to pastors who are pursuing a DMin degree while serving in congregational ministry. The scholarship may be awarded up to three times per person. Applicants must reapply each year. (Applicants must live or serve a congregation within OPSF’s thirteen-state service area.)
Awards are provided on a rolling basis until funds have been expended for the year. Prior Doctor of Ministry Scholarship recipients will be considered in the third and fourth quarters of the year to allow new applicants the first opportunity for funding.
